Q: Is 2,503,250 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,503,250 is a composite number.

Why is 2,503,250 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,503,250 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 17 19 25 31 34 38 50 62 85 95 125 155 170 190 250 310 323 425 475 527 589 646 775 850 950 1,054 1,178 1,550 1,615 2,125 2,375 2,635 2,945 3,230 3,875 4,250 4,750 5,270 5,890 7,750 8,075 10,013 13,175 14,725 16,150 20,026 26,350 29,450 40,375 50,065 65,875 73,625 80,750 100,130 131,750 147,250 250,325 500,650 1,251,625 and 2,503,250, with no remainder.

Since 2,503,250 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,503,250, it is a composite number.
